Summary Statement

Join a team dedicated to inclusive recreation by leading programs, camps, and community-based activities for individuals with disabilities. This position plays a key role in ensuring activities are safe, engaging, and well-coordinated, while exercising independent judgment and supporting staff and supervisors in delivering high-quality experiences. This position is open to all applicants age 19 and older.

Essential Functions

  • Leads groups of adults with disabilities involved with Boise Parks and Recreations adaptive recreation program on pre-established activities and outings in the community such as bowling, sporting events, movies, dinner, dances, etc. Assists supervisor and staff in coordinating safe, fun and appropriate activities. Will be required to drive a 12-or 15-passenger van to transport participants to/from activities.
  • Ensures the safety of the participants while in the community. Properly manages money for group activities in the community.
  • Occasionally works one-on-one with individuals with disabilities so they can fully integrate into parks and recreation programs.
  • Acts as liaison between parks and recreation and activity destinations.
  • Performs other duties as assigned. Nothing in this job description restricts managements right to assign or reassign duties and responsibilities to this position at any time.

Working Conditions

The physical effort characteristics and working environment described here are representative of those an employee encounters while performing the essential functions of this job.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

Physical Efforts

While performing the duties of this job the employee is frequently lifting/carrying up to 50 pounds. Also, the employee is always pushing/pulling up to 10 pounds. The noise level is always moderate. Work includes sensory ability to talk and hear. Work in this position also includes close vision, distance vision, peripheral vision and depth perception. Employees will sit, stand and walk. Additional physical efforts include: must be able to transfer individuals in and out of adaptive equipment and to physically react quickly..

Working Environment

The work environment will include inside conditions and outdoor weather conditions. Employees will also drive a vehicle as part of this position.Will be leading programs inside of community centers and out in the public.
